In short
Kalannie is a suburb of Western Australia, postcode 6468, home to 147 residents with an established residential profile. Located in the Mount Marshall local government area (Remote Australia) and roughly 229 km from the Perth CBD.

NBN & connectivity
Fixed Wireless serves 91.7% of the 132 resolvable premises in Kalannie. Most premises here are served by NBN Fixed Wireless from a nearby tower. Speed is shared with neighbours and weather-sensitive; plans up to NBN 100 are available where signal allows.
- Fixed Wireless: 91.7%
- Sky Muster (Satellite): 8.3%
